Incredible and extremely rare late 1920s brooch by French parurier Louis Rousselet. Three dimensional dome constructed primarily of extremely fine wire, with amber vauxhall glass rhinestones covering the surface in floral pattern - a round central stone and half-moon montees as flower petals - and finished with a trombone clasp closure. Absolutely stunning piece, in beautiful condition for its age, with some signs of wear consistent with age and use. For example, the stones are all secure to the brooch, but some are looser than others. I’m not certain, but I believe this may be one of the pieces Rousselet created for Chanel. In 1929, they created a series of pieces for Chanel using the same montee rhinestones, e.g., necklaces where the stones were arranged in a slightly different pattern to create rosettes. But I have not been able to pin down with certainty which couture house this particular design was created for.
